Islanders Lock in No. 1 Pick and Pursue Second Top-10 Selection

Darche plans to select defenseman Matthew Schaefer with the first pick, seeking to acquire a second top-10 selection as part of the rebuild.

Overview

  • Darche confirmed the Islanders will not trade the No. 1 overall pick, virtually ensuring Matthew Schaefer goes first.
  • The general manager said he is open to dealing assets for another top-10 slot, with Long Island native James Hagens as a leading target.
  • Darche has overhauled the hockey operations staff, hiring new NHL and AHL coaches along with assistant GM Ryan Bowness.
  • Key restricted free agents Noah Dobson and Alexander Romanov carry arbitration rights and are expected to be retained amid outside interest.
  • Recent moves by Metro Division rivals highlight the urgency to inject youth and speed after missing the playoffs.
